## Runbook: Canary Gating Rules

For the weekly sync: Driftgate canaries promote automatically only when error rate stays under 0.5% and p95 latency within 10% of baseline for 30 minutes. Any manual override must be logged in the gating table with a reason. Rollbacks reset the observation window. Gate decisions and override history are stored in the deploy-metrics database; query it using the connection string below.

primary connection of hadup-kajeg = clickhouse://rusath_svc:lTa6pgZ@db-a477.plorvaforge.corp:5432/oliox

**Q2 Planning Note — Hollis & Brack Term Sheet**

Finance folks, quick one: Hollis & Brack finally sent their term sheet for the Windlass integration. Headline terms are decent — 70/30 revenue split our way, three-year exclusivity in the Averly region, and a co-marketing fund they'll seed. Legal is chewing on the indemnity clauses. We want signatures before quarter close. What this unlocks for us strategically is summarised in the note below.

internal memo for bahap-yagug: Headcount on the Ulaix team goes from 3 to 100 by the end of January. Gross margin on Ulaix came in at 10 percent against a plan of 15 percent.

**Q: How should plugin authors load test the Cartwheel checkout flow?**

Use the sandbox tier only. Production endpoints rate-limit synthetic traffic and may suspend your plugin key. Keep runs under 200 RPS and tag requests with your plugin slug. Results appear in the Cartwheel dev console within an hour. If you need a higher ceiling for a scheduled test, request one in advance.

alerts address for kajog-tadup: druox@plorvanet.internal

Ticket #4412 — DiagramDen vault locked after undo/redo spike. While reviewing the new undo stack for the shape editor, the test vault in Flowrick staging auto-locked after too many redo replays triggered the tamper check. Nothing's corrupted; we just need to reopen it to finish the review. The recovery passphrase for the staging vault is below.

unlock words, fahog-yahof: belael-holael-eliius-joreth-tamax-olimir-norwyn-holwyn-fraath-lamius-norwyn-druys-soriel